FOOTPRINTF-Scale Racing System
The footprint system was developed as Matter wheels understood that despite urethane durometers, there are other factors that affect the feel of the wheel to the skater.
The critical element affecting the feel is the footprint, the larger the footprint, the softer the wheel.
Therefore, we believe its more important to measure the footprint of the wheel relative to the other wheels in a sequence. Matter uses an F - scale rating system.
F0 being the hardest, F1 the next hardest, and so on. This footprint scale is relavent only to each individual family or sequence, meaning that an F1 Juice will not have the same traditional hardness rating as an F1 XG wheel.HCT

Energy Management Technology
During the development of Hollow Core Technology, it became apparent that Hollow wasn’t the answer for ALL surfaces and all conditions. Clearly, there are certain styles of skating and certain terrains where additional flex is required to allow the skater to better manage energy. So, back to the lab we went and the end result is the two-piece, EMT flex technology. EMT has road and track applications and one will find the EMT option throughout the Matter line. All track wheels features EMT with convertible wheel technology.OT
Dffset Technology
Our OT hub follows the same idea as EMT. The advantage is our ability to manage the energy to give specific foot prints and flex without sacrificing roll, grip and wear. The difference of OT vs. EMT is the hub construction. The EMT is based on a hollow core constructions vs. the OT is based on a solid hub construction. The EMT has some advantages compared to OT such as better rebound, improved flex for better power transfer and lighter weight. Yet there are quite some skaters that prefer a solid hub system, and for them the IMAGE core offers the perfect solution. OT can be found in the IMAGE wheels series.USW
Ultrasonic Welding
Sonic Welding (USW) was incorporated is the method of joining two parts by converting electrical energy into heat energy by high frequency mechanical vibration and is suitable for plastics or metals. One part of the assembly is set in motion in order to cause intense friction between the two pieces, one of which remains held in place. This movement is provided by a vibrating component called a sonotrode which is applied at right angles to the surface of the part to be welded.
Friction is localized at the interface of the assembly. The resulting heat quickly melts the plastic which flows and causes a chemical bond. After it has cooled, a solid homogeneous weld between the two components is formed. The vibration frequency of the sonotrode is 20 to 40 kHz which is outside the perception limit of the human ear.

Convertible Wheel Technology
CWT (Convertible Wheel Technology) was developed specifically for the Track. While EMT allows the skater to manage energy, CWT provides additional footprint on the track for better grip. Combined with EMT Juice, XG, Code Red, Nuclear or now also Defcon, the skater will have the opportunity, NO MATTER THE SURFACE, to find the suitable track setup.
